Bold colors, geometric patterns, and botanical profiles abound in this collection of canvas prints from Erik Abel. Inspired by a love of the ocean, surfing, and travel, Abel’s work articulates the spirit of the water and awe of nature. His graphic imagery unfolds along with the story of his paintings. Accents peek through, unexpectedly revealing layers of color while loose strokes of colored pencil create detail and dimension. Abel now lives and works in Southern Oregon. His original pieces have been featured in galleries across the country and abroad while his commercial work has attracted clients including Patagonia, Reef, REI and Billabong.
